Multi-Language WordPress and WPMU

Simple.

  1. Go to http://codex.wordpress.org/WordPress_in_Your_Language and find the version in the language of your choice.

  3. Open the zip file and extract the contents of wp-content/language.  Then upload this directory to your WordPress/WPMU installation.  (wp-content/language doesn’t exist in the default English WordPress install.)
  4. To set the language go to Settings -> General and look near the bottom of the page.  You’ll now have an option that wasn’t there before.

Note that the language files are the same for WPMU and WordPress – the WPMU-specific “Site Admin” menu translations are included in the language files. Nice!
